(Halay at Home) is a popular series of instructional and entertainment videos designed to teach the traditional Kurdish and Turkish folk dance, Halay , in a simplified way for home practice . Gültepe, a folk dance instructor and content creator, gained significant traction on platforms like YouTube and TikTok by breaking down complex footwork into energetic, easy-to-follow routines.
